Understanding Cable Management Rings

What are cable management rings?

Cable management rings, also known as cable rings or cable organizers, are devices used in telecommunications networks to organize and manage the cables and wires used in the network infrastructure. These rings are typically made of plastic or metal and are designed to hold the cables in place, preventing them from tangling, twisting, or becoming damaged. Cable management rings are available in various sizes and configurations to accommodate different types and quantities of cables.

Why are cable management rings important for telecommunications networks?

Cable management rings play a crucial role in telecommunications networks for several reasons. Firstly, they help to maintain the integrity and reliability of the network by keeping the cables organized and properly routed. This prevents signal interference and ensures optimal performance. Additionally, cable management rings make troubleshooting and maintenance easier by providing clear pathways for access to the cables. They also enhance the overall safety of the network by minimizing tripping hazards and reducing the risk of cable damage or breakage. By investing in cable management rings, telecommunication networks can improve efficiency, reduce downtime, and create a more organized and professional appearance.

Importing Regulations and Requirements

Overview of importing regulations for telecommunications equipment

Importing telecommunications equipment, including cable management rings, into the USA involves complying with certain regulations and requirements set by the United States government. The importation of such equipment is regulated by various agencies, such as the Federal Communications Commission (FCC), the Customs and Border Protection (CBP), and the U.S. Department of Commerce. These regulations aim to ensure that imported telecommunications equipment meets the necessary standards and does not pose any safety or security risks.

Specific requirements for importing cable management rings into the USA

When importing cable management rings into the USA, it is important to ensure compliance with specific requirements. These may include providing documentation certifying the safety and compliance of the products, such as test reports and conformity certificates. Additionally, the products must meet the technical specifications and labeling requirements set by the FCC and other regulatory bodies. Importers should also be aware of any import restrictions or prohibitions that may apply to cable management rings.

Import duties and taxes

Importing cable management rings into the USA is subject to import duties and taxes. The specific rates of these charges depend on various factors, including the country of origin, the value of the goods, and the classification of the products under the Harmonized System (HS) codes. Importers are responsible for paying these fees, which are typically determined by the CBP. It is important to consider these costs when calculating the overall expenses associated with importing cable management rings.

Customs documentation and procedures

Importing cable management rings requires submitting the necessary customs documentation and following specific procedures. This includes preparing an invoice or bill of sale that accurately describes the goods, their value, and their country of origin. Importers must also complete a customs declaration form, which provides information about the imported products and their intended use. Additionally, certain permits or licenses may be required for importing cable management rings, depending on the nature of the goods and the regulations of the country of origin and the USA.

Dealing with customs brokers and freight forwarders

Working with experienced customs brokers and freight forwarders can simplify the shipping and customs clearance process when importing cable management rings into the USA. Customs brokers are professionals who assist with the necessary documentation, customs declarations, and compliance with customs regulations. Freight forwarders, on the other hand, handle the logistical aspects of the shipment, such as coordinating transportation, ensuring proper packaging, and managing the transport to the final destination. Their expertise and knowledge of the shipping and customs procedures can help streamline the importation process and ensure compliance with all necessary requirements.

Navigating Customs Procedures

Documentation required for customs clearance

Navigating customs procedures when importing cable management rings into the USA involves providing the necessary documentation for customs clearance. This documentation typically includes an invoice or bill of sale, a packing list specifying the contents of the shipment, and a commercial invoice indicating the value of the goods. Other documents that may be required include a customs declaration form, certificates of origin, and any relevant licenses or permits. Ensuring that all required documentation is complete, accurate, and properly organized helps to facilitate a smooth customs clearance process.

Customs declaration process

The customs declaration process is a critical step in importing cable management rings into the USA. It involves submitting a customs declaration form that provides detailed information about the imported products, their value, and their country of origin. The declaration form enables customs authorities to assess the import duties and taxes applicable to the shipment. Importers should ensure that the customs declaration is accurate and transparent, as any misrepresentation or omission of information can lead to penalties or delays in customs clearance.
